Persons who cannot afford a computer in 2012

  • Value: 8.8 %
  • Change vs 2011: −1 % (−10.2 %)
  • Position in history: below the 21-year average (average — 8.9667 %)
  • Series maximum — 30 % in 2005 (7 years ago)
  • Series minimum — 3.4 % in 2023
  • Value date: 1 January 2012
  • Source: Eurostat
